BN Purandare Lecture: Assisted reproductive technologies – The future is bright
Prof Hrishikesh Pai offers a visionary look of the cutting-edge technologies driving progress and possibility in reproductive healthcare.
In the 2025 BN Purandare Lecture, Prof Hrishikesh Pai delved into the remarkable progress and promising future of assisted reproductive technologies (ART). As innovations in reproductive science continue to advance at a rapid pace, this lecture examined the latest developments in ART and their transformative impact on fertility care worldwide.
Prof Pai highlighted how emerging technologies are revolutionising reproductive medicine. Through a comprehensive overview of both scientific progress and clinical application, the session explored how these breakthroughs are improving success rates, expanding reproductive options and offering renewed hope to individuals and couples seeking to build families.
This recorded session provides a forward-looking perspective on the evolving landscape of fertility treatment, showcasing the innovations that are shaping the next generation of reproductive healthcare and underscoring why the future of ART is indeed bright.
